- Biniam HabtamuDec 28, 2020 · 5 years agoSure! The tax implications of virtual currency on Form 1040 can vary depending on how it is used. If you have bought or sold virtual currency, you may need to report it on your tax return. The IRS treats virtual currency as property, so any gains or losses from its sale or exchange are subject to capital gains tax. It's important to keep track of your transactions and calculate the cost basis of your virtual currency holdings to accurately report your gains or losses.

When it comes to Form 1040, the IRS wants to know if you've made any money from your virtual currency investments. If you've sold or exchanged virtual currency, you'll need to report it on Schedule D of your tax return. The amount of tax you owe will depend on how long you held the virtual currency and your tax bracket. So, make sure to keep good records of your transactions and consult a tax professional if you're not sure how to report your virtual currency gains or losses.
